ADAS Archaeology and Historic Building team is seeking a Senior Supervisor/Project Officer on a fixed-time 6-month contract.
Hybrid role based out of Romsey, Boxworth or Derby, with flexible location and a focus on fieldwork, reporting and client liaison.
The role requires substantial commercial archaeology experience, ACIf A/CIf A accreditation, strong communication skills and a clean UK driving licence.
Salary up to £36,572 plus benefits is offered.
